ARLINGTON, Texas -- Rangers right-hander Lucas Harrell has been placed on the 15-day disabled list a day after coming out of his start with a right groin strain.Texas made the move before its series finale Wednesday night against Oakland, also recalling right-hander Nick Martinez from Triple-A Round Rock.Harrell faced only 12 batters Tuesday night and left after two innings in his fourth start since the Rangers acquired him in a trade from Atlanta three weeks ago. The right-hander is 1-0 with a 5.60 ERA in 17 2/3 innings since the trade.Texas also announced its pitching rotation for the upcoming weekend series at Tampa Bay, with All-Star lefty Cole Hamels going Friday before A.J. NEW ORLEANS -- The two co-defendants in the drug and rape case that brought down one-time NFL star Darren Sharper were formally sentenced Thursday to lengthy prison terms -- after hearing blistering condemnations from two of their victims in open court.Brandon Licciardi, a former suburban sheriffs deputy, was sentenced to 17 years in federal prison; former restaurant worker Erik Nunez was sentenced to 10 years. Both pleaded guilty to state and federal charges that they drugged women so that they, and Sharper, could rape them. Prosecutors said in court documents that the case involved multiple women assaulted on various dates in 2013.Both accomplices apologized. Nunez read a statement rapidly and sometimes unintelligibly. Ive always respected women and held them in high regard, he said at one point.More emotional, Licciardi spoke haltingly, telling one victim, I made a terrible decision to leave you in the hands of a monster, an apparent reference to Sharper.Sharper has pleaded guilty or no-contest to drug and sexual assault cases in Louisiana and three other states. In state court, where both are expected to receive the same sentences next week, Licciardi pleaded guilty to sex trafficking and forcible rape. Nunez pleaded guilty to sexual battery.During a 14-year NFL career, Sharper played in two Super Bowls, one with the Packers as a rookie and one with New Orleans Saints when they won in 2010. He retired in 2011 and was working as a broadcast NFL analyst when allegations that he drugged and raped women began to surface.Under a deal that was expected to net him about nine years in prison, Sharper pleaded guilty or no-contest in state and federal courts to charges that he drugged and sexually assaulted women in Arizona, California, Nevada and Louisiana -- all part of a multistate global plea deal announced in early 2015.But U.S. District Judge Jane Triche Milazzo, saying there were as many as 16 victims in the four states, rejected the sentence as too light. That led to his 18-year federal sentence, followed by a 20-year state sentence that attorneys said was essentially the same given state and federal sentencing practices and credit for time served.
